The operation described consists of an anatomic en bloc dissection of posterior and deep cervical lymphatic channels and nodes. The procedure is cosmetically and functionally acceptable and provides adequate clearance of lymphatics from the posterior part of the neck. It is recommended for selected malignant cutaneous lesions of the parietal, occipital and mastoid scalp and of the skin of the posterior part of the neck.
